Garage Door Installation Cost Overview in Newark

The cost of garage door installation in Newark, New Jersey, averages around $2,300 per door, with a typical range from $1,000 to $5,700. This pricing can vary significantly based on the project scope and local market conditions, making it essential for homeowners to consider both the initial cost and long-term benefits.

Factors That Affect Garage Door Installation Cost in Newark

Several factors contribute to the variability in garage door installation costs in Newark, NJ:

  • Materials: High-quality materials like steel or aluminum tend to be more expensive than cheaper options such as vinyl. The choice of material significantly affects overall cost.
  • Labor Costs: Labor rates vary by contractor and can be influenced by the complexity of the installation, including any additional work needed for compatibility with existing structures or systems.
  • Size and Complexity: Larger doors or those requiring more specialized components increase costs due to the time and materials required. More complex installations might include multiple door units or special features like automatic openers.
  • Seasonal Variations: Installation costs can fluctuate based on when work is scheduled, with higher fees during peak seasons when demand for services is highest.
  • Permits and Fees: Depending on local regulations, additional permits or fees might be required, adding to the overall cost of installation. Always check with your local government for any potential expenses.

Tips to Save Money on Garage Door Installation in Newark

Pro Tip

Always get at least 3 quotes from licensed contractors in Newark before starting your project. Comparing bids can save you 10–30% on garage door installation costs.

To save money on garage door installation in Newark, homeowners can follow these tips:

  • Get Multiple Quotes: Request detailed quotes from at least three reputable contractors to compare costs and services. This ensures you receive the best possible deal for your project.
  • Select Energy-Efficient Options: Investing in energy-efficient materials, like insulated doors or high-performance seals, can reduce utility bills over time and potentially lower the initial cost through government incentives or rebates.
  • Choose Off-Season Installation: Scheduling your installation during off-peak seasons when demand is lower may result in significant savings on labor costs. However, ensure that weather conditions are suitable for outdoor work.
  • DIY Prep Work: Preparing the area around where the new door will be installed can save you money on labor. Clearing debris and ensuring a level surface reduces the need for additional fees or extra work from contractors.
